Overview

We are seeking a Traffic Safety Engineer to join Traffic Safety Services Department.

Traffic Safety Services Department is responsible for promoting safe driving culture & enhance roads' safe driving experience, by providing best in class traffic safety services which contribute to the kingdom 2030 vision.

Your primary role is to perform professional specialized transportation & traffic safety engineering tasks and participate in developing efficient and effective traffic safety initiatives, policies, and action plans for safer working and living environment within the company facilities. Position’s tasks would include but not limited to roadways design reviews, accidents investigation/analysis, road safety assessments, development of remedial countermeasures.

Key Responsibilities

  • Act as a technical lead to various traffic safety engineering related work tasks.
  • Interface with company representatives & government authorities to address traffic and transportation safety improvements in the Eastern Province.
  • Provide technical support to various internal & external entities to improve traffic mobility and traffic safety.
  • Support proponents in developing projects scopes, project proposals, and schematics for packages related to roads and traffic safety improvements.
  • Review and provide initial inputs on design & specifications of roadway schemes within and around company facilities utilizing applicable industry standards and guidelines.
  • Participate in the efforts of developing initiatives and identifying areas of traffic safety improvements based on the international best practices and emerging technologies
  • Participate on investigations of traffic accidents involving company employees and contractors within the company premises.
  • Program, coordinate, and prioritize technical tasks activities and assign them to pertinent resources
  • Enhance internal technical capacity by: establish proper training and develop efficient processes for knowledge sharing/transfer.
  • As the successful candidate you will hold a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ering from a recognized and approved program. An advanced degree with emphasis on Transportation & Traffic Engineering is preferred.
  • You must have 15 years of experience in Traffic Engineering & Transport Planning Studies, including at least 10 years in Traffic Safety-related projects.
  • You must have technical proficiency in road design, transport planning & traffic safety studies.
  • You must be familiar with local & international standards & guidelines.
  • Professional certification & licenses are a requirement.
  • You will have the ability to conduct site visits & site assessment.
  • You must be able to use transportation/traffic analysis & simulation software’s
  • Project management and resource planning knowledge is a requirement.
  • You must be able to demonstrate outstanding written and verbal communication.
